This handprint frog keepsake craft is perfect for kids of all ages! It’s an easy and fun acitivity to commemorate a special day or moment.
Craft Supplies:
- Lily Pad Printable – on our landing page
- White Cardstock Paper
- Washable Green Craft Paint
- Small Paper Plate
- Foam Paint Brush
- Sharpie Markers
- Baby Wipes
Directions:
- First print the free lily pad template printable {listed above} in color on white paper. You only need ONE printable per frog craft.
- Next up, squirt some green craft paint on a paper plate.
- Paint one of your child’s hands and press it in the center of the printable to create the body of the frog. The fingers will the frog legs so make sure they are facing downwards.
- Use baby wipes to clean off excess paint.
- To finish off the hand print frog, add some facial features such as a tongue and eyes with a marker and add any other embellishments {like stars, glitter, rhinestones} you see fit.
- Then display/gift away the finished handprint frog keepsake piece proudly!
